Patches in original Xen Security Advisory 155 cared only about backend drivers while leaving frontend patches to be "developed and released (publicly) after the embargo date". This is said series. Marek Marczykowski-Górecki (6): xen: Add RING_COPY_RESPONSE() xen-netfront: copy response out of shared buffer before accessing it xen-netfront: do not use data already exposed to backend xen-netfront: add range check for Tx response id xen-blkfront: make local copy of response before using it xen-blkfront: prepare request locally, only then put it on the shared ring drivers/block/xen-blkfront.c | 110 ++++++++++++++++++--------------- drivers/net/xen-netfront.c | 61 +++++++++--------- include/xen/interface/io/ring.h | 14 ++++- 3 files changed, 106 insertions(+), 79 deletions(-) base-commit: 6d08b06e67cd117f6992c46611dfb4ce267cd71e -- git-series 0.9.1